Metal Complexes Of Polybenzimidazole Ligand: Their Synthesis And Inductive Roles In DNA Condensation

Two polybenzimidazole ligands:N,N,N',N'-tetrakis(2'-benzimidazolylmethyl)-1,4-di -ethylene amino glycol ether(EGTB) andl,1,4, 7,7-pentakis(1H-benzimidazol-2-ylmethyl) -1,4,7-triazaheptane(DTPB) have been synthesised. We also synthesise five metal complexes with EGTB or DTPB.All of the compounds[Cu2(EGTB)(Ac)2](Ac)2·7H2O(1),[Cu2(DTPB)Cl2]Cl2·5H2O·2CH3OH(2),[Co2(DTPB)Cl3]Cl(3),[Mn(DTPB)Ac]Ac·8H2O (4),[Mn2(DTPB)(NO3)2(H2O)2] [Mn2(DTPB)(NO3)2·H2O·CH3OH](NO3)4·4CH3OH·H2O (5) have been characterized by X-ray diffraction, the structure characters are as follows:1 is a dinuclear complex .Each of the center Cu(Ⅱ) is bonded to three N atoms,one O atom from EGTB and two O atoms from Ac- ,to form a octahedron geometry.2 is a dinuclear complex .One of the center Cu(Ⅱ) is bonded to two benzimidazolyl nitrogens, two amine nitrogens from DTPB and two Cl- ,to form a tetragonal pyramid;the other is bonded to three benzimidazolyl nitrogens, one amine nitrogens from DTPB and a Cl- ,to form a trigonal bipyramid.3 is a dinuclear complex .One of the center Co(Ⅱ) is bonded to three benzimidazolyl nitrogens, two amine nitrogens from DTPB and a Cl- ,to form a octahedron geometry;the other is bonded to two benzimidazolyl nitrogens, one amine nitrogens from DTPB and two Cl- ,to form a trigonal bipyramid.4 is a mononuclear complex .The center Mn(Ⅱ) is bonded to three N atoms,two amine nitrogens from DTPB and one O atom from Ac-,to form a octahedron geometry.5 is a dinuclear complex. One of the center Mn(Ⅱ) is bonded to three benzimidazolyl nitrogens, two amine nitrogens from DTPB and two O atoms of NO3- ,to form a pentagonal bipyramid;the other is bonded to two benzimidazolyl nitrogens, one amine nitrogens from DTPB,one O atom and two O atoms of water molecule ,to form a octahedron geometry.Interactions between compound 4,5 and DNA have been investigated by ultraviolet -visible spectra and fluorescence spectra.The results manifest the two compounds can bond DNA.The inductive roles of the two complexes in DNA condensation have been studied by gelose gel electrophoresis,RALS and DLS.The results indicate the compounds can induce DNA condensation in neutral condition and different DNA condensates have been detected by TEM.
